A dual diagnosis is a diagnosis of a co-occurring addiction and mental health disorder. This could be an occurrence of both a drug and alcohol addiction along with a bipolar or anxiety disorder, or a gambling addiction coupled with clinical depression. It may be numerous things all co-occurring simultaneously, with particular disorders making other problems worse or even stimulating them. For example, someone's alcohol abuse might be stimulated by their desire to self-medicate because of their anxiety or depression. Someone might be suffering from depression due to their substance use. It takes a team of professionals to ascertain the root causes of each of the issues the person is battling and come up with a rehabilitation strategy that will successfully treat both concurrently so that individuals can lead a drug-free and mentally healthy lifestyle.

Having the client get addiction rehabilitation at one center and then having the person also receive help from a mental health professional at a different facility isn't ideal. The most effective dual diagnosis drug treatment facilities can work on both co-occurring disorders in one facility simultaneously. Long term inpatient rehab is recommended for clients with more severe addictions and mental health disorders, because these individuals benefit most in a setting where they are fully immersed and where there are no time limits to their recovery.
